From the moment a project begins, a contractor should make positive that all administrative duties are addressed. This contains acquiring essential permits and licenses required for work to begin. Without these approvals, a project might face vital delays or even halt altogether, ultimately impacting timelines and costs.


Budget administration is one other crucial duty. Contractors must provide accurate estimates and develop a budget that aligns with the client’s expectations. This entails not solely materials costs but in addition labor, overhead, and any unforeseen expenses that might arise through the project’s lifespan.

Communication serves because the spine of efficient project administration. A contractor acts because the intermediary between consumer, subcontractors, suppliers, and regulatory our bodies. Effective communication helps to guarantee that everyone concerned understands their roles and the project’s progress. Regular conferences and updates can forestall misunderstandings and hold the project on observe.


Safety is a paramount concern in construction. A contractor is answerable for fostering a safe work surroundings, following safety laws, and making certain that workers wear correct protecting gear. Safety coaching and regular security audits are essential to attenuate the chance of accidents, which may lead to accidents and delays.

Quality control can't be ignored. A contractor must be positive that the work meets established standards and specs. This includes selecting reliable subcontractors and suppliers, and persistently monitoring progress to guarantee that supplies and workmanship meet the desired quality stage.


Scheduling is a vital facet of project management. A contractor creates a project timeline that outlines every part of the development course of. This schedule needs to be adhered to intently, with flexibility inbuilt to accommodate any potential setbacks, corresponding to unhealthy climate or provide delays.

Document administration is another crucial accountability. Contractors must hold thorough information of all contracts, change orders, schedules, and correspondence. These documents not only function a reference point throughout the project but additionally present crucial evidence in case of disputes.


Financial oversight is intricately linked to budget administration. A contractor should monitor expenses and be sure that all monetary transactions, corresponding to payments to subcontractors and suppliers, are executed timely. This stage of oversight helps maintain trust amongst all events and ensures that the project remains financially viable.


A contractor must also be ready to deal with adjustments within the project scope. Change orders might arise as a end result of consumer requests or unforeseen issues. A responsible contractor evaluates the implications of such adjustments on each the finances and schedule, speaking clearly with all stakeholders concerned.


At the project's conclusion, contractors play an essential function in the handover course of. This contains the final inspections, addressing any punch-list objects, and ensuring that the project meets the client's expectations. Follow-up after project completion is also essential for maintaining relationships and securing future work.
